Steps to Make the Perfect Protein Coffee Shake
Follow these comprehensive steps to create your delicious protein coffee shake:
Step 1: Brew Your Coffee
Start by brewing a strong cup of coffee. Use your preferred coffee-making method. For added convenience, you can also prepare your coffee ahead of time and refrigerate it for a chilled shake.
Step 2: Gather Your Ingredients
Make sure you have all the ingredients on hand. Measure out the appropriate amounts. A basic recipe might include:
| Ingredient | Amount |
|---|---|
| Brewed coffee | 1 cup |
| Protein powder | 1 scoop (about 20-25g) |
| Liquid base (milk or water) | 1/2 cup |
| Banana (optional) | 1 medium |
| Nut butter (optional) | 1 tablespoon |
| Cocoa powder (optional) | 1 tablespoon |
Step 3: Blend the Ingredients
In a blender, combine the brewed coffee, protein powder, and your chosen liquid base. If you’re using any optional ingredients like banana or nut butter, add them now. Blend on high speed until you achieve a smooth and creamy consistency.
Step 4: Adjust Consistency and Flavor
Taste your shake and adjust as necessary. If the shake is too thick, you can add more liquid. If you prefer a sweeter shake, consider a drizzle of honey or maple syrup.
Step 5: Serve and Enjoy!
Pour your protein coffee shake into your favorite glass or shaker bottle. For a fun presentation, you may want to garnish it with a sprinkle of cocoa powder or a dash of cinnamon. Enjoy your nutrient-packed shake at home or take it with you for a nutritious boost on the go!
Customization Ideas for Your Protein Coffee Shake
One of the best aspects of a protein coffee shake is its versatility. Whether you’re following a specific diet or just exploring flavor combinations, there are plenty of ways to customize your shake:
Flavor Variations
- Mocha Delight: Add cocoa powder and a splash of vanilla extract for a rich, chocolatey flavor.
- Nutty Banana: Blend in a banana and a tablespoon of your favorite nut butter for a creamy texture and delightful taste.
- Spicy Kick: Try a pinch of cayenne pepper for a spicy twist that can also boost metabolism.
- Berry Boost: Add a handful of frozen berries for a fruity twist and a blast of antioxidants.
Diet-Friendly Options
Depending on your dietary needs, you can easily tailor your protein coffee shake to fit:
- Vegan: Use plant-based protein powder and a plant-based milk alternative.
- Keto-Friendly: Opt for a zero-carb protein powder, unsweetened almond milk, and a high-fat nut butter.
- Low Sugar: Use unsweetened cocoa powder and skip any added sugars or syrups.

Can I make a protein coffee shake without protein powder?
Yes, you can certainly make a protein coffee shake without using protein powder. There are several whole food alternatives that provide protein, such as Greek yogurt, cottage cheese, silken tofu, or nut butters. These ingredients not only add protein to your shake but also contribute creaminess and flavor.
Incorporating higher-protein foods like these can lead to a shake that remains nutritious and satisfying without relying on powdered supplements. Experimenting with various ingredients allows for greater creativity and can help you find a combination that best fits your taste preferences while maintaining a robust nutritional profile.

How can I sweeten my protein coffee shake naturally?
To sweeten your protein coffee shake naturally, there are several options available. One of the most popular is using ripe bananas. They not only provide sweetness but also contribute creaminess to the shake. Other fruit, like dates or dates syrup, can also be blended in for natural sweetness without refined sugars.
Alternatively, you can use natural sweeteners such as agave syrup, honey (if you’re not strictly vegan), or maple syrup for a bit of extra flavor. You might also consider adding a dash of cinnamon or vanilla extract, which can enhance the overall taste without significantly increasing the sugar content.
Can I prepare my protein coffee shake in advance?
Yes, you can definitely prepare your protein coffee shake in advance! To maintain freshness, consider blending all the ingredients except for the coffee and any fresh fruits or delicate items, then store the mixture in the refrigerator. You can add the coffee just before consuming to ensure that your shake remains at its best taste and texture.
If you want to save even more time, you can pre-measure and store the dry ingredients, such as the protein powder and other blendable ingredients, in separate containers or bags. When you’re ready to enjoy your shake, simply combine the pre-measured ingredients with freshly brewed coffee and any additional liquid, blend, and enjoy!
How can I make my protein coffee shake more filling?
To make your protein coffee shake more filling, consider adding high-fiber ingredients. Oats, chia seeds, or ground flaxseeds not only provide extra nutrition but also promote satiety. These ingredients help to slow digestion, keeping you feeling full for longer periods, which is especially beneficial during busy mornings or after workouts.
Another way to enhance the shake’s filling power is by increasing the protein content. Using ingredients like Greek yogurt, silken tofu, or nut butter can add more protein and healthy fats, creating a more satisfying shake. By carefully selecting these components, you can develop a shake that fuels your day while keeping cravings at bay.
